JA basketballers step it up at Centro Championships

Although losing top-shooter Roy Hibbert to injury, Jamaica's men dominated British Virgin Islands 71-56 to stay in contention at the Centro Basketball Championships in the Dominican Republic.

Akeem Scott stepped up with 18 points and Andre Smith 15, as Jamaica joined the US Virgin Islands who they play Friday on three points.

Hibbert had returned to Orlando for an MRI on his injured knee which could end his participation in the tournament.

The Indiana Pacers centre scored a game high 19 points in Jamaica's opening 68-62 loss to hosts Dominican Republic.
